Redistributable Code—Limited Use. Provided that you ALSO comply with the terms of Section 4.1.3, Microsoft grants you a nonexclusive, royalty-free right to reproduce and distribute the object code form of those portions of the SOFTWARE PRODUCT listed in REDIST.TXT as Limited Use Redistributable Code, and/or the Microsoft Data Engine technology (“MSDE”) (collectively, the “Limited Use Redistributable Code”).
Redistributable Code—Limited Use. If you are authorized and choose to redistribute Limited Use Redistributable Code, in addition to the terms of Section 4.1.1, you must also comply with the following.

  • Redistribution If any amount owing by an Obligor under any Finance Document to a Finance Party (the recovering Finance Party) is discharged by payment, set-off or any other manner other than through the Facility Agent in accordance with Clause 9 (Payments) (a recovery), then: (a) the recovering Finance Party shall, within three Business Days, notify details of the recovery to the Facility Agent; (b) the Facility Agent shall determine whether the recovery is in excess of the amount which the recovering Finance Party would have received had the recovery been received by the Facility Agent and distributed in accordance with Clause 9 (Payments); (c) subject to Clause 29.3 (Exceptions), the recovering Finance Party shall, within three Business Days of demand by the Facility Agent, pay to the Facility Agent an amount (the redistribution) equal to the excess; (d) the Facility Agent shall treat the redistribution as if it were a payment by the Obligor concerned under Clause 9 (Payments) and shall pay the redistribution to the Finance Parties (other than the recovering Finance Party) in accordance with Clause 9.7 (Partial payments); and (e) after payment of the full redistribution, the recovering Finance Party will be subrogated to the portion of the claims paid under paragraph (d) above, and that Obligor will owe the recovering Finance Party a debt which is equal to the redistribution, immediately payable and of the type originally discharged.

  • Multi-Storey Allowance (a) In addition to the wage rates and site allowances provided in this Agreement, Multi-Storey Allowance will be applicable in accordance with clause 23.3 of the Award. The applicable rate for Multi-Storey Allowance shall be as follows: (b) As at 1 March 2024: From the commencement of building to 15th floor level $0.70 per hour From the 16th floor level to 30th floor level $0.82 per hour From the 31st floor level to 45th floor level $1.27 per hour From the 46th floor level to 60th floor level $1.65 per hour From the 61st floor level onward $2.00 per hour (c) Multi-Storey Allowance will be adjusted annually in accordance with CPI (All Groups, Melbourne) movements measured in the twelve-month period ending the previous December quarter effective as of 1 March from 2025 onwards, rounded to the nearest cent.
